I read the quick start manual.  You should hold the phone in the same
orientation as the document you are scanning.  I went into the
settings and landscape was off.  I scanned a page of a book and held
my phone camera down with the phone in portrait position.  It also
suggests that instead of the double tap, you use the split finger tap.
Place two fingers on the left side of the phone, lift one finger and
tap the phone.  It should take a picture and begin reading very soon.

>> If you hold the phone 8-10 inches (20-25 CM) above the document, making
>> sure the camera is centered above it, then you should get fairly accurate
>> results. This is where the field of view report, and the tilt guidance
>> come in extremely handy!
>> You don't need to turn your arm at awkward angles, if anything, you may
>> need to raise, or lower the phone, move it backwards, or forwards, but
>> nothing unnatural. Also, Make sure the phone has the same orientation as
>> the document (portrait or landscape), and let the built-in guidance
>> features help you orient the last bit if needed.

>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Baltimore, Maryland (September 18, 2014): The National
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Federation of the
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Blind, the nation's leading advocate for access to print
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> by the blind,
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> has applauded the release of KNFB Reader, a new app for
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> the iPhone and
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> other Apple iOS devices, which uses the phone's camera
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> and
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> state-of-the-art optical character
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>                                   recognition (OCR)
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> technology to
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>              give
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> the blind instant access to the contents of print
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> materials. Members of
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> the National Federation of the Blind have worked with
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> K-NFB Reading
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Technology, Inc., which developed the app along with
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Sensotec, Inc. KNFB
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Reader is now available in the iTunes app store.
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Mark Riccobono, President of the National Federation of
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> the Blind, said:
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> "The National Federation of the Blind has been involved
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> for forty
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>          years
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> in the development of technology that helps blind people
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> to acquire
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> access to the various print materials that we all
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> encounter from day to
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> day. Ever since our first collaboration with Ray Kurzweil
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> to develop the
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Kurzweil Reading Machine, which was the size of a
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> household appliance,
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> we have been interested in the development of better and
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> more portable
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> reading technology. Print on office documents, flyers,
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> letters,
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>         menus,
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> labels, and throughout our environment is still a part of
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> everyday life,
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> even with the increased electronic transmission of
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> documents. Now
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> revolutionary technology that resides on the phones that
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> many of us
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> carry each day provides instant access to the printed
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> word. We can hear
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> our mail or the menu at our favorite restaurant spoken
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> with the iPhone's
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> built-in text-to-speech technology, or read it in Braille
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> with a
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> refreshable Braille display. This app will fundamentally
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> change the
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> everyday lives of many blind people, helping us to get
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> the information
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> we need and live the lives we want."
